Barack is an African name that means "blessed" and also a derivative of the Hebrew name "Baruch." Hussein, a common Arabic name, means "handsome, good, small."
Obama is an African Luo name (male) from Western Kenya (Nyanza Provice) which may derive from "obam," connoting "bending" or "leaning."
